2. Different Selections of Hairdressing Shears
Hairdressing shears can be found in different types, each tailored for specific reducing methods and hair types. Here's a failure of one of the most typical types:

Straight Shears: Additionally called common shears, these are the most commonly made use of type and appropriate for basic cutting, cutting, and layering. They come in various lengths, normally ranging from 4.5 to 7 inches.
Thinning Shears: Featuring 1 or 2 serrated blades with teeth, thinning shears are made use of to minimize bulk, mix layers, and produce texture without getting rid of excessive length. They are excellent for clients with thick or curly hair.
Texturizing Shears: Comparable to thinning shears however with less teeth, these shears are created to add quantity and structure to the hair. They are ideal for developing contemporary, rough styles.
Long-Blade Shears: These shears have longer blades (typically over 6 inches) and are made use of for scissor-over-comb techniques, factor cutting, and creating blunt cuts. The longer blade permits smoother, more reliable cutting of large sections.
Curved Shears: With a slight curve along the blade, rounded shears are perfect for producing rounded forms, such as edges and split bobs, and for trimming around the ears and neck.
Left-Handed Shears: Made specifically for left-handed stylists, these shears have a reversed blade and take care of design to supply comfort and control for left-handed cutting.
3. Ergonomic Functions of Hairdressing Shears
Ergonomics plays a critical duty in the design of hairdressing shears. Correct ergonomics help reduce pressure and fatigue during expanded cutting sessions, making sure convenience and control. Key ergonomic functions to seek include:

Offset Manages: Offset takes care of are created to lower thumb movement and finger stress, advertising a more natural cutting setting. This layout is particularly useful for stylists that execute repetitive cutting movements.
Crane Takes care of: Crane manages have a descending angle, permitting the stylist to cut with a straighter wrist placement. This decreases the danger of repetitive strain disorder, such as carpal tunnel syndrome.
Swivel Thumb Shears: These shears feature a rotating thumb ring that enables higher flexibility of motion and lowers stress and anxiety on the thumb and wrist. This feature is ideal for stylists with existing hand or wrist issues.
Weight and Balance: The weight and balance of the shears are also essential ergonomic elements. Light-weight shears minimize hand tiredness, while a well-balanced pair offers better control and accuracy.
4. Keeping the Intensity and Long Life of Hairdressing Shears
Correct upkeep is vital to maintain hairdressing shears in optimum problem. Sharp, well-kept shears not only guarantee accurate cuts but also lengthen the life of the device. Here are some maintenance tips:

Regular Cleansing: Tidy your shears after each usage with a soft, dry cloth to remove hair, oil, and residue. Stay clear of making use of water, as it can cause rusting. Instead, use a disinfectant spray designed for salon devices.
Lubrication: Apply a couple of declines of shear oil to the pivot screw consistently. Lubrication aids preserve smooth operation and protects against the blades from coming to be rigid.
Sharpening: Hairdressing shears should be properly developed every few months, depending on use. Boring blades can trigger split ends and harm the hair.
Appropriate Storage: Shop your shears in a safety case or bag when not being used. This avoids unintended decreases or contact with various other tools that can damage the blades.
Adjusting Stress: The stress screw must be adjusted consistently to make sure smooth cutting activity. As well loose, and the shears will certainly fold the hair; also tight, and they will certainly trigger hand exhaustion.
